Imaging intramolecular energy transfer in conjugated polymers by single chain spectroscopy

Not Accessible

Your library or personal account may give you access

Abstract

We report on the time resolved polarized emission from individual conjugated polymer chains as a function of temperature. Besides observing intrachain energy transfer in real time, we can also infer dephasing times from homogeneous linewidths.
